Terrasolid's TerraScan LiDAR Processing Software now available from Airborne 1
California & Helsinki, April 17, Airborne 1 Corporation and Terrasolid Ltd. have announced the implementation of a Master Distributor agreement. Airborne 1 is now an Authorized Master Distributor for Terrasolid's software products including the popular TerraScan LiDAR Data Processing package.
TerraScan is a dedicated software solution for processing LiDAR data that runs on top of Bentley's Microstation. Unlike many older software packages, TerraScan can easily handle the tens of millions of points common in large LiDAR data sets, in fact as many as 40,000,000 points per GB of RAM. As a dedicated LiDAR data solution, all data handling routines are tweaked for optimum performance when handling large laser point clouds. Its versatile
manipulation, visualization and classification tools prove useful in topographic surveying, surveying of transmission lines, flood plains, proposed highways, stockpiles, forest areas or urban centers. An intuitive GUI and common Windows interface make deploying and optimizing TerraScan a straightforward task in any production environment. Customizable macro programming, user-defined project structures and automated batch processing make TerraScan an extremely flexible and versatile tool that allows end users to move away from proprietary, black box software solutions and take control of their own LiDAR data. TerraScan reads points directly from any ASCII XYZ text file, allows users to work in an open-source binary format for smaller file size and faster access and easily allows conversion between various standard formats.
In North America TerraScan is available both as a full-featured LiDAR data manipulation and classification tool and as a low-cost LiDAR data viewer. The viewer includes all the features of the full package except for the ability to automatically classify the laser data. List price for the full version is $4,950 US, for the Viewer $295.
